Snoop Dogg Unveils His Wax Figure at Las Vegas' Madame Tussauds

Attending the unveiling of his wax figure at Madame Tussauds Museum in Las Vegas, Snoop Dogg is seen donning the same outfits with the ones worn by his statue.

Previously boasting on his Twitter account about him being immortalized in wax, Snoop Dogg has been photographed attending the unveiling of his replica at the famous Madame Tussauds Museum in Las Vegas on Monday, April 20. He reportedly took along the 50 kids he coached on the Pomona Steelers football team to the event.

Posing with his wax work, Snoop was spotted sporting the same outifts with the ones worn by the statue. As claimed by his representative last week, Snoop's wax figure costs $300,000.

With the unveiling of his wax figure, Snoop thus becomes the first living rap icon who is immortalized in wax at Madame Tussauds Museum. He, at the same time, is the third rap artist whose wax work is put on display at the famous wax house after the late Tupac Shakur and Notorious B.I.G.
